With GSM/LTE collaborative spectrum scheduling, GSM and LTE spectrums are dynamically scheduled in a granularity of 200 KHz according to the traffic load. When the GSM traffic load falls below a given threshold, certain GSM spectrum resources are released for LTE. It dynamically extends LTE bandwidth when there is low GSM traffic load and can balance GSM and LTE spectrum utilization based on regional GSM traffic statistics. GSM/LTE dynamic bandwidth extension supports dynamic spectrum re-farming at LTE narrow bands. For the configuration of 20M LTE bandwidth, GSM can use 1.4 MHz of the 2 MHz reserved bandwidth. GSM/LTE band-in spectrum overlay has an innovative filter algorithm and unique bandwidth compression technique that maintains zero or even negative GSM/LTE guard bandwidth and improves spectrum efficiency. Normally, a 200 KHz guard band is required to mitigate inter-system interference. The same network capacity can be achieved with less bandwidth and no performance loss. It brings GSM spectrum gain by allocating and releasing frequency resources according to traffic tide (except some higher-priority TRX, such as BCCH TRX). GSM dynamic frequency allocation is a unique feature that has been commercially deployed.
